Rev. Surv. Ugochukwu Obiora Chime, (FNIS; born October 1st) is a Nigerian real estate developer, surveyor, and entrepreneur. He is the Group Managing Director and Chief Executive Office<nowiki/>r of COPEN Group, a conglomerate specializing in real estate development, construction, consultancy, facility management, geo-information, and surveying. Under his leadership, COPEN Group has delivered over 2,000 homes, significantly contributing to the housing sector in Nigeria. Career Chime has had a career spanning over four decades in surveying, real estate development, and management. He is a Fellow of the Nigerian Institution of Surveyors (FNIS) and has held various leadership roles, including: * He was the former National President of the Real Estate Developers Association of Nigeria (REDAN). * President of the Enugu State Chamber of Commerce, Industry, Mines, and Agriculture (ECCIMA). * Former Chairman of the Enugu Housing Development Corporation. In recognition of his contributions, Chime was honored with the African Housing Leadership Award (AHIS) in 2021. He also received the Real Estate Developer of the Year award at the Abuja Housing Show awards in 2016.
